Immigrants from Haiti vs Yakama Unemployment Among Ages 45 to 54 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 221,731,051 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Haiti and unemployment rate among population between the ages 45 and 54 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.043 and weighted average of 5.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 19,676,341 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Yakama and unemployment rate among population between the ages 45 and 54 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.042 and weighted average of 5.7%, a difference of 10.1%.
